正交试验在露天矿境界优化参数选取中的应用 被引量:1

APPLICATION FOR PARAMETER SELECTION OF PIT OPTIMIZATION IN ORTHOGONAL EXPERIMENTS

摘要 露天矿境界优化中,销售价格、边界品位、入选品位和边坡角等是影响优化结果的主要因素。随着市场和经济条件的变化,这些参数的取值会在一个范围内波动,在进行境界优化时需要选取最优参数组合。本文以某金矿为例,将优化参数作为变量,境界优化结果中的盈利和成本作为响应,利用正交表安排参数组合,在软件中进行最终境界优化。通过对16组优化结果的统计,得出了盈利最大和成本最小的组合方案;在优化结果中对参数的每个水平进行分析,评出了每个参数的最优水平;用最优水平的参数组合进行境界优化,与前面较好的结果进行对比,得出最优的露天境界结果。 Sale price,cut-of grade,beneficiation feed grade and final angle are very important affecting factors in pit optimization.With the changes in market and economic condition,these parameters always fluctuate in a range,so we need to select the optimal parameters.Taking a gold mine for example,the article which choose the parameters as variables,the profit and cost in optimization results as the response,uses orthogonal table to arrange the parameters which are used in pit optimization experiments.Through the experiments we can find out the optimal parameter combination which can achieve maximum profit and minimum cost.we also analyze each level of parameter in the optimization results,and decide the optimal level of each parameter;use the optimal level of parameter to pit optimization again,and then compared with the maximum profit or minimum cost,we find out the best optimal result.
